It's an axios compatible API client and an optional expressJS compatible API server with the following features: - really simple centralized API declaration - typescript autocompletion in your favorite IDE for URL and parameters - typescript response types - parameters and responses schema thanks to zod - response schema validation - powerfull plugins like fetch adapter or auth automatic injection - all axios features available - @tanstack/query wrappers for react and solid (vue, svelte, etc, soon) - all expressJS features available (middlewares, etc.) Table of contents: - What is it ? - Install - Client and api definitions : - Server : - How to use it on client side ? - Declare your API with zodios - API definition format - Full documentation - Ecosystem - Roadmap - Dependencies Install Client and api definitions : or Server : or How to use it on client side ?
